Искусственный интеллект (ИИ) стремительно развивается‚ и нейронные сети‚ его ключевая составляющая‚ все чаще используются в различных сферах жизни. Вы‚ вероятно‚ слышали о нейросетях‚ о том‚ как они способны создавать реалистичные изображения‚ переводить текст‚ анализировать данные и даже писать музыку. Но как понять‚ готовы ли вы погрузиться в мир нейронных сетей и освоить этот мощный инструмент?
Прежде чем вы решите начать обучение‚ важно оценить свои знания и навыки‚ а также понять‚ какие ресурсы вам понадобятся.
Ключевые навыки и знания
Чтобы успешно освоить нейронные сети‚ вам потребуется⁚
- Базовые знания математики⁚ Алгебра‚ линейная алгебра‚ основы теории вероятности и математической статистики.
- Понимание основ программирования⁚ Знание одного из языков программирования‚ таких как Python‚ R‚ C++‚ JavaScript‚ позволит вам создавать и запускать модели нейронных сетей.
- Опыт работы с данными⁚ Понимание типов данных‚ способов их обработки‚ очистки‚ подготовки к обучению нейронных сетей;
- Знание основных алгоритмов машинного обучения⁚ Регрессия‚ классификация‚ кластеризация‚ а также принципы работы алгоритмов машинного обучения в целом.
- Умение анализировать данные⁚ Способность интерпретировать результаты обучения‚ определять причины ошибок и улучшать модели.
Дополнительные навыки
Некоторые навыки могут сделать ваше обучение более эффективным⁚
- Опыт работы с фреймворками для машинного обучения⁚ TensorFlow‚ PyTorch‚ Keras‚ Scikit-learn.
- Знание облачных платформ⁚ AWS‚ Google Cloud‚ Azure.
- Опыт работы с инструментами визуализации данных⁚ Matplotlib‚ Seaborn‚ Tableau.
Как проверить свою готовность
Чтобы проверить свою готовность к изучению нейросетей‚ ответьте на следующие вопросы⁚
- Уверенны ли вы в своих знаниях математики и программирования?
- Есть ли у вас опыт работы с данными и понимание основных алгоритмов машинного обучения?
- Готовы ли вы потратить время и усилия на изучение новых технологий?
- Есть ли у вас мотивация и интерес к изучению нейросетей?
Если вы ответили утвердительно на большинство вопросов‚ то вы‚ скорее всего‚ готовы начать обучение.
Начните с основ
Если вы новичок в области машинного обучения‚ начните с изучения основ. Существует множество онлайн-курсов‚ книг и ресурсов‚ которые помогут вам получить необходимые знания. подробнее о навыках использования нейросетей
Погружайтесь в практику
Лучший способ освоить нейронные сети ⎻ это практика. Создавайте свои проекты‚ решайте реальные задачи‚ участвуйте в конкурсах по машинному обучению.
Не бойтесь экспериментировать
Мир нейросетей постоянно развивается‚ появляются новые алгоритмы‚ фреймворки и технологии. Не бойтесь экспериментировать‚ пробовать новые вещи‚ чтобы оставаться в курсе последних тенденций.
Изучение нейросетей ⸺ это инвестиция в будущее
Нейронные сети ⎻ это мощный инструмент‚ который может помочь вам в решении различных задач‚ от оптимизации бизнес-процессов до создания новых продуктов и услуг. Вложение времени и усилий в изучение нейросетей ⸺ это инвестиция в ваше будущее.
Мне нравится